Arjan van de Ven wrote:
>>
>> static int pirq_via_set(struct pci_dev *router, struct pci_dev *dev, int pirq, int irq)
>> {
>>- write_config_nybble(router, 0x55, pirq, irq);
>>+ write_config_nybble(router, 0x55, pirq == 4 ? 5 : pirq, irq);
>> return 1;
>> }
>
>
>
> you missed the
>
>>+ return (x >> 4);
>
> in the original patch... so your code is NOT identical.
Look at read_config_nybble...
return (nr & 1) ? (x >> 4) : (x & 0xf);
Can you spell out which part is different? I don't see it.
